hi pupsandcups,
teaching hrs are pretty long even though it may seem like a half day job. usually, u have to start at 7am and stay back till 4 or 5pm to mark, attend workshops, meetings, to conduct remedial classes and CCAs. after that, still have to mark worksheets at home. some days can end pretty late till 9 or 10 pm. the time u can really have a good rest is usually during dec. if u want to try out, perhaps u can sign on as a contract teacher to see if u like the work.if u are happy, then u sign on with MOE. Hi bbsnmum,
salary depends on what maid you getting. Indo about $280. Filipino about $320. got experience maybe more. Levy with kids or elderly folks at home is $200. If not, $295. Agency fees differs, can range from $99 onwards... but must see what they covers and no of replacement etc...
